The Cascade Mountains of the Pacific Northwest are among the most expansive in the lower 48. This presents endless opportunities for exploration, but it also presents challenges in terms of finding viewpoints from which to digest the enormity. Yet, nature saw fit to solve this challenge in the form of a line of volcanoes stretching from northern California to the Canadian border. The volcanoes are taller and more prominent than the rest of the densely populated peaks, and offer lofty vantages from which to enjoy the surrounding landscape for hundreds of miles in any direction.

A late summer morning found me around 11,000’ high on a route called Ptarmigan Ridge on the NW side of Mount Rainier. The low sun of the morning played with the lazy summer haze in each of the countless valleys, and gave depth and dimension to the amazing topography stretching all the way to the rugged peaks of North Cascades National Park.

These moments of wonder are why I choose to call this part of the world my home.
